What is ClickUp MCP?

ClickUp MCP is a Model Context Protocol server that connects your ClickUp workspace to AI agents like Claude, ChatGPT, and Gemini. It lets you query tasks, projects, sprints, and workloads in natural language — without logging into ClickUp or building custom integrations — all through Improvado's hosted MCP server.

Which ClickUp data can I access through the MCP server?

Tasks, subtasks, lists, folders, spaces, sprints, goals, milestones, custom fields, assignees, due dates, time estimates, comments, and workspace members. Everything accessible via ClickUp's REST API is queryable through your AI agent.

Can the AI agent create and update tasks or only read data?

Both. Read operations cover querying tasks, sprint statuses, and workload data across spaces. Write operations include creating tasks, updating statuses and assignees, moving tasks between lists, adding comments, and setting priorities. All operations respect your ClickUp token permissions.

Does this work across multiple ClickUp workspaces?

Yes. Improvado's MCP server supports multi-workspace configurations. You can query tasks and projects across all your ClickUp workspaces in a single prompt without switching accounts.

Is my ClickUp data secure through the MCP server?

Yes. Improvado stores all ClickUp API tokens in an encrypted vault certified to SOC 2 Type II. The AI model never has direct access to credentials — requests flow through Improvado's secure proxy with prompt injection protection enabled.

How quickly can I set this up?

Under 60 seconds. Add the MCP server URL to your Claude Desktop or Cursor config, authenticate with a ClickUp API token, and start querying. Improvado users already connected to ClickUp can begin immediately via app.improvado.io/agent.
